The characteristics of urban solid waste processed by Qinghai city's municipal solid waste incinerator (MSWI) are as follows: food waste 47.78%, paper 6.85%, rubber 9.41%, textile (fiber) 2.72%, wood and bamboo 1.75%, ash and soil 0%, bricks, tiles, and ceramics 27.22%, glass 2.89%, metal 1.21%, and others 0.17%. Moisture content is 55.81%, higher calorific value of 5367.35 kJ/kg, and lower calorific value of 3624. 71 kJ/kg. The average heat efficiency of waste heat power generation is taken as 22%; during the waste heat supply process, there is no different form of heat and energy conversion, resulting in a relatively high thermal efficiency, averaging 64%; through a comprehensive analysis of the waste heat power generation process and direct heating process, 15% of the heat generated during the waste incineration process is used for power generation, and 56% is used for direct heating.
